L77F (p.Leu77Phe) variant of ATP13A2 (Q9NQ11)
L77F (p.Leu77Phe) in ATP13A2 (Q9NQ11) is a missense change. Clinical records from ClinVar, EBI, and UniProt describe it as uncertain significance in the context of Kufor-Rakeb syndrome; Autosomal recessive spastic paraplegia type 78; not provid. The available variant effect predictions contribute to a CATVariant prioritization score of 0.18 / 1. The record also includes population frequency data, published literature, and structural context.
